Clara Chia

I think this bakery is hit or miss? They have a lot of really good-looking cakes in the bakery case. I needed a cake, so I stopped in. It def smells good inside!

I got a 6” tiramisu cake that cost $30. It looked pretty, but I thought it tasted ok. It had a good sweetness level. The cake had alternating layers of jelly-mousse stuff with coffee cake. The top was creamy and had a layer of cocoa powder. The fruit tart cake was also $30; maybe I should have gotten that one instead.

I saw a chicken pot pie in the case next to the register and decided to try it for ~$3. It was warmed and delicious !!!! The layers were flaky and buttery. The inside chicken pot pie didn’t burn my mouth, and it was a good savory taste. This was a nice surprise from a bakery visit.

Bakers spoke English. Credit card/Apple Pay accepted.

Kat L

Great Hong Kong style baked goods. Family run for generations. Coffee rolls, egg tart and coconut cream buns are delicious. In the 90s I use to get these shipped to another state because my family loved it so much.
